Online Transcription Software and Service Market Size
Global Online Transcription Software and Service Market size was USD 4.46 Billion in 2024 and is projected to touch USD 4.99 Billion in 2025 to USD 12.38 Billion by 2033, exhibiting a CAGR of 12% during the forecast period [2025–2033].
The Global Online Transcription Software and Service Market is experiencing strong momentum due to increasing demand across healthcare, education, and legal industries. The US Online Transcription Software and Service Market alone accounts for a considerable portion, driven by 38% demand in healthcare, 26% in media, and 18% in the education sector.

Online Transcription Software and Service Market Trends
Online Transcription Software and Service is undergoing a paradigm shift due to increased automation, industry-specific applications, and AI adoption. 49% of enterprises are now deploying AI-powered transcription platforms, showcasing a strong trend toward automation. The rise of remote work has accelerated demand, especially in media and education, where 43% of content creators and academic institutions have adopted such solutions. Over 39% of businesses now rely on mobile-friendly transcription platforms to support hybrid workforces. Furthermore, 36% of surveyed professionals highlighted the importance of multilingual transcription tools, indicating a growing global demand. Cloud-based services account for 54% of market adoption, largely due to scalability and data accessibility. Integration with video conferencing tools has become standard, as 33% of users prefer real-time captioning. The healthcare sector is also witnessing change, with 41% of medical professionals using secure transcription solutions to enhance documentation efficiency. Meanwhile, law firms represent 29% of users embracing AI-powered legal transcriptions. In the US, over 61% of transcription demand stems from sectors aiming to reduce human error and improve compliance documentation. As these technologies evolve, the need for customizable, secure, and scalable platforms continues to grow rapidly across industries.

Segmentation Analysis
The Online Transcription Software and Service market is segmented based on type and application. The type includes software and services, while application segments span across medical, education, BFSI, law, media, and others. Services contribute to 58% of the market due to growing demand for outsourced transcription, while software holds 42% due to rising use of AI and NLP tools. Application-wise, medical transcription leads with 34% share, followed by law at 21% and media at 19% respectively. Custom features and integration drive the choice of application-specific solutions among enterprises.
By Type
- Services: Services dominate with 58% market contribution. Outsourcing transcription offers flexibility and scalability. Around 41% of medical and legal sectors rely on third-party service providers to streamline documentation. Moreover, 36% of startups prefer service-based models for cost control.
- Software: Software accounts for 42% of the market. Around 33% of firms opt for AI-integrated tools. 29% highlight real-time transcription capabilities. Customizable software with multilingual support is adopted by 31% of educational institutions globally.
By Application
- Medical: Medical transcription leads with 34% usage. Around 43% of hospitals use online tools for patient documentation and diagnosis support.
- Educate: Education follows with 18% share. 38% of universities and online platforms use transcription for video lecture archiving and accessibility.
- BFSI: BFSI holds 10% share. 31% of financial institutions use transcription to meet audit and compliance needs.
- Law: Legal transcription captures 21% share. 46% of law firms depend on accurate and secure transcription tools for court proceedings.
- Media: Media accounts for 19%. Around 44% of journalists and media houses use transcription for interviews, subtitles, and podcast archiving.
- Others: 8% of demand comes from sectors like market research, HR, and consulting with over 27% using transcription for survey insights.
Regional Outlook
![]()
North America
North America accounts for 42% of the global market. The US drives most of this demand, with 48% of legal and medical transcription service usage originating from the region. Around 44% of enterprises prefer SaaS-based transcription solutions. The education and media sectors jointly contribute 35% of regional adoption. AI-integrated platforms are used by 51% of large enterprises.
Europe
Europe holds a 24% share in the global Online Transcription Software and Service Market. UK and Germany are key contributors with 38% and 27% of adoption, respectively. Multilingual transcription tools are utilized by 43% of businesses in the region. Approximately 32% of media firms use real-time transcription. Cloud deployment is preferred by 41% of European enterprises.
Asia-Pacific
Asia-Pacific captures 21% of market share, driven by strong demand from India, China, and Japan. Over 36% of educational institutions in the region use transcription tools to support remote learning. Around 33% of startups integrate transcription APIs into customer service workflows. Multilingual support is critical, with 45% of platforms providing local language options.
Middle East & Africa
Middle East & Africa represents 13% of the market. Adoption is led by the UAE and South Africa, contributing 52% of the region’s usage. Legal and government sectors account for 39% of demand. About 29% of firms rely on outsourced services due to limited in-house capabilities. Cloud-based adoption stands at 34%, mainly for real-time and multilingual transcription features.
